RaiseMe is a for-profit startup founded in August 2014 that allows high school students to input personal academic achievements to qualify themselves for college scholarships. [1] [2] As of January 2019, over 285 universities offered scholarships through RaiseMe. [3] [4] Scholarship money is delegated through "Micro-Scholarships", where dollar ... Raise.me won a very small prize in a Gates-sponsored business app contest, completely unrelated to any students' actual scholarships. Of greater concern is that there is no evidence the accumulated "dollars" actually add to what a student might have received in a total aid package from any university. A micro-scholarship is an amount of money that students are eligible to earn based on individual achievements during college. They are awarded by 4-year colleges and universities who partner with RaiseMe, and each 4-year college creates their own micro-scholarship program or list of micro-scholarships they offer for different achievements.

You can follow your favorite colleges, add your grades and …Jun 1, 2017 · Overall, Raise.me says the average student earns $22,500 in scholarships. Raise.me isn’t the only way to get that money. Raise.me isn't increasing the total amount of scholarship money available. In fact, many of the colleges that are Raise.me members—particularly the private ones—already give out sizable merit scholarships. Fundraising on GoFundMe is easy, powerful, and trusted. If you haven't already, you need to apply and be accepted to the 4-year college, then enroll. The college will reference your RaiseMe scholarships when determining financial aid for you, and as long as all requirements have been met, you'll be awarded at least the amount earned on RaiseMe in scholarships, grants, etc.How does RaiseMe work?
